Transaction 8b34e0faf660cb9fa26a631d35544e8610d143fc0344be5382abf0102afa32f3
1 Input
1 Output
-
8b34e0faf660cb9fa26a631d35544e8610d143fc0344be5382abf0102afa32f3:0
- value
- 133394
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 729ac76e4f5ff2b590b141184f3e532069b5e190 OP_EQUAL
- address
- 3C8zNeXH9FRUkGcxWie497WSF9mavJ9L7J